Doria Population - Araria, Bihar

Doria is a large village located in Kursakatta Block of Araria district, Bihar with total 430 families residing. The Doria village has population of 2300 of which 1235 are males while 1065 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Doria village population of children with age 0-6 is 436 which makes up 18.96 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Doria village is 862 which is lower than Bihar state average of 918. Child Sex Ratio for the Doria as per census is 832, lower than Bihar average of 935.

Doria village has lower liter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Doria village was 56.81 % compared to 61.80 % of Bihar. In Doria Male literacy stands at 71.11 % while female literacy rate was 40.37 %.

Caste Factor

In Doria village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 37.30 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.04 % of total population in Doria village.

Work Profile

In Doria village out of total population, 867 were engaged in work activities. 97.81 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 2.19 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 867 workers engaged in Main Work, 328 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 500 were Agricultural labourer.
